Ideal Candidate:
Serve as a Human Resources Specialist with responsibility for planning, developing, and carry out a full range of comprehensive management advisory services for recruitment, placement, affirmative employment, and employee relations for assigned organizations and subordinate activities for FIELDCOM. Provides strategic and technical guidance and seasoned consultative management advisory services for a wide range of human resources management (HRM) areas for complex and dynamic organizations within the command. Provides staff level advice and policy interpretation to high level management officials, program managers, and other HR specialists. Trouble-shoots complex and sensitive problems and issues requiring a mastery of advanced human resources principles, concepts, practices, laws, regulations, and a wide range of analytical methods and techniques to resolve HRM problems not susceptible to treatment by standard methods. Provides customer support solutions to inquiries on the full range of difficult staffing issues. Resolves problem cases and issues guidance to prevent recurrence of problems. Communicate with leaders and multiple liaisons from various organizational level using a variety of interpersonal communication and problem solving techniques and skills to identify, analyze, and recommend or negotiate solutions to unique and/or systematic problems.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:

  1. Knowledge of federal Human Resources (HR) laws, executive orders, regulations, policies, directives, instructions, and concepts governing HR functions such as merit promotion, recruitment and placement, affirmative employment, employee and labor-management relations, employment performance and conduct issues, and other programs.
  2. Knowledge of advanced federal human resources management (HRM) principles, concepts, practices, analytical methods, a wide range of qualitative and quantitative techniques, and relationships of various HR disciplines as well as seasoned consultative skill sufficient to resolve complex HRM problems not susceptible to treatment by standard methods.
  3. Knowledge of organizational structures, missions, objectives, operating programs, key positions, and administrative/protocol policies and procedures.
  4. Skill in conducting reviews and analyzing and assessing HR program operations to include identifying deficiencies; measuring compliance, consistency, and effectiveness; and making recommendations for enhancements and improvements.
  5. Ability to communicate both orally and in writing and to establish and maintain effective and positive working relationships.
